In a significant move for its European ambitions, Tesla has cleared a critical regulatory hurdle, securing approval to begin real-world testing of its Full Self-Driving (Supervised) technology on public roads in Sweden. This green light from the Swedish Transport Administration marks the first sanctioned urban testing of the advanced driver-assistance system in Europe, moving the company's vision of autonomous driving from simulation to Scandinavian streets.
A Strategic Foothold in the European Market
The approval grants Tesla the ability to test FSD (Supervised) v14 in the municipality of Nacka, a suburb of Stockholm. This is not a public rollout but a controlled data-gathering phase, crucial for adapting the EV giant's North American-developed system to Europe's unique driving environments. The region presents a complex proving ground with distinct road signage, traffic patterns, and weather conditions. Successfully navigating these challenges in Sweden is widely seen as a prerequisite for any future broader European deployment, making Nacka a vital first testbed.
Navigating the Regulatory Landscape
This milestone underscores the intricate regulatory journey required for advanced automotive software in Europe. Unlike the more unified federal approach in the U.S., the European Union and its member states maintain stringent and varied safety standards. Tesla's strategy involves working with individual national authorities to demonstrate capability and safety. Securing this permit from the Swedish Transport Administration suggests a collaborative review of Tesla's safety case and testing protocols, potentially setting a template for engagements with other European regulators.
The testing phase will be closely monitored, with data on the system's performance in handling roundabouts, narrow urban lanes, and specific right-of-way scenarios being paramount. This real-world feedback loop is essential for the iterative development that defines Tesla's approach to Full Self-Driving. The company must prove not only technical competence but also a robust operational safety framework to satisfy European authorities.
Implications for Tesla's European Trajectory
For Tesla owners and investors, this development is a tangible signal of progress on a long-awaited capability. European Tesla drivers have watched as FSD has evolved overseas, and this testing is the first concrete step toward potentially unlocking a major, value-added feature for vehicles already on the road. It represents a future revenue stream and a key competitive differentiator in the crowded European electric vehicle market.
However, patience remains essential. Regulatory testing is a deliberate process, and a full public release in Sweden—let alone Europe—is likely still months, if not years, away. The immediate implication is increased validation of Tesla's technical roadmap and a stronger negotiating position with other EU nations. For investors, it mitigates the risk of European regulatory stagnation, while for owners, it fuels the anticipation that their vehicles' latent autonomous potential may one day be activated on home roads.
